Fund your smart wallet

Only send funds on the supported networks such as Ethereum, Base, Linea, Polygon, Arbitrum and BNB Chain. To learn more about account abstraction, you can visit here.

Let's assume you want to fund your smart wallet on the Linea network. First, make sure you select Timeless X smart account on Linea network by following the instructions on the images below.

  1. Open Timeless X, then tap on the small profile icon at the top right corner

  2. Make sure Linea network is selected under “Your Account

  3. Tap on your smart wallet (the one with the AA tag)

  4. Tap the 3-dots at the top right corner of your wallet’s PFP, then select Copy Address

  1. Open MetaMask, then tap the blue round button at the bottom center of MetaMask

  2. Select the Send option

  3. Paste the address of your smart wallet on the To: field, then tap Next. Enter the amount of funds to send, tap Next, then tap Send on the final screen.

The transaction will now be processed. Funds should arrive in your Timeless X wallet shortly after the transaction is confirmed. Remember, transaction times can vary based on network congestion and gas fees. It's always good to check for any transaction fees or additional details before confirming the send action.

Fund your smart wallet from an exchange

As long as your centralized exchange (e.g. Binance, Coinbase, Bybit, MEXC) supports the networks (Ethereum, Base, Linea, Polygon, Arbitrum, BNB Chain) supported by Timeless X, you can send funds to your smart wallet.

  1. Open Timeless X, then tap on the small profile icon at the top right corner of the screen.

  2. On the pop-up, make sure your preferred is selected under “Your Account”.

  3. Tap on your smart account (the one with the AA tag).

  4. Tap the 3-dots at the top right corner of your wallet’s profile picture, then select Copy Address.

  1. Navigate to your centralized exchange's Withdraw page:

    1. Choose the asset you want to send to your Timeless X smart account

    2. Paste the Timeless X address you copied

    3. Choose a supported network (You're advised to send funds on a Layer2 network since your smart contract transactions will be cheaper)

    4. Enter the amount and complete the withdrawal process

Make sure you do not send funds directly from your smart wallet to your centralized exchange address. Your smart wallet operates primarily as a smart contract, and any transfers to a centralized exchange are recognized as smart contract deposits. Currently, centralized exchanges do not support these types of deposits, which means your funds will not be credited to your exchange account. To withdraw funds from your smart wallet, you should first transfer them to your regular wallet within Timeless X. Subsequently, you can send them from this regular wallet to your exchange address. Follow steps 1-4 to locate your regular wallet's address. Please avoid transferring funds using the Ethereum network. Being fundamentally a smart contract account, each interaction with your smart wallet constitutes a smart contract request. This type of transaction incurs considerably higher gas fees on the Ethereum network when compared to those on a Layer 2 network. High gas fees are a result of the more complex and resource-intensive processes required for executing smart contract requests on the Ethereum. Therefore, for more cost-efficient transactions, consider using an L2 network, which is designed to offer lower fees and faster processing times.
